WebJun 8, 2024 · 14. Asparagus (Asparagus officinalis) Like most food-bearing perennials, asparagus will take 2 to 3 years of growth before you can take your first harvest. But once it has established, asparagus plants will provide food for many years to come. Asparagus can tolerate some shade throughout the day. WebSpiked water-milfoil is an aquatic plant, living submerged in slow-flowing streams and ditches, as well as lakes, ponds and flooded gravel pits.
